Father Judge High School
Highlights of our indoor track team's state final results from last weekend at Penn State University. Anthony McClatchy '26 placed 2nd overall in the Boys 400m in a time of 48.64, improving his School Record.The 4x400m Relay of Ryan Teye-Williams '27 (50.33 seconds), Gavin Hutz '26 (52.47 seconds), Nicholas Rodriguez-Ortz '27 (51.19 seconds) and Anthony Mcclatchy '26 (48.76 seconds) finished 6th overall in a time of 3:22.74, breaking last years' School Record of 3:23.53.

For the first time in program history, FJXC has qualified its entire Varsity 7 to the PIAA State Championship in Hershey, PA. The boys claimed the school’s first ever District 12 Runner-Up plaque in the AAA Large School race. The 7 Varsity members all claimed top-25 medals en route to securing an automatic team qualifying spot for Hershey: Samuel Perez (Jr) - 4th Colin Dunne (Jr) - 9thColin Schultz (Jr) - 11thLucas Ho (Jr) - 13thLuke Muscarnero (Fr) - 21stAdam Goldsmith (Jr) - 23rdElwood Cubbage (Fr) - 25th

The team captured 2nd place in the PCL Championship Meet Saturday 10/18 @ Belmont Plateau. Top performer was Colin Dunne who finished in 13th place. Colin led fellow juniors Sam Perez, Colin Schultz, & Lucas Ho. This group of junior runners finished in 15th,16th, & 17th place respectively. Freshman Luke Muscarnero finished in 18th place. The team will compete in the PIAA District XII Championships on Thursday 10/23. >
